Product Description

Description

Engineered for high-accuracy industrial process automation, the CS1W-PDC55 functions as a high-density, isolated process analog input module within the Sysmac CS-series PLC platform. This module provides reliable multi-channel analog measurement, translating raw field signals from sensors, transmitters, and transducers into precise digital values for the PLC CPU. Designed for robust deployment in demanding control environments, the CS1W-PDC55 process analog input unit features high electrical isolation and noise immunity to maintain loop integrity across complex automation architectures.

Installation Guidelines

Ensure the rack power supply is completely switched off before mounting or removing the CS1W-PDC55 from the backplane. Route all analog signal wires in separate conduits from high-voltage AC power cabling to minimize electromagnetic interference. Always connect the functional ground terminal on the PLC rack to a dedicated, low-impedance ground point to ensure maximum measurement accuracy and noise mitigation.
